What is RTP?
Return to Player (RTP) is a crucial metric that indicates the percentage of wagered money a slot machine returns to players over time. For example, a slot with a 96% RTP will theoretically return $96 for every $100 wagered. This percentage varies between games, typically ranging from 92% to 98%. Higher RTP games provide better long-term value, making it essential to research before playing.
Volatility Matters
Volatility, or variance, describes how often and how much a slot pays out. Low volatility slots offer frequent small wins, while high volatility games feature rare but substantial payouts. Your choice depends on your bankroll and risk tolerance. Patient players with larger budgets often prefer high volatility, whereas casual players might enjoy low volatility games.
